What does an assistant line producer do?

An Assistant Line Producer supports the Line Producer in managing the daily operations of a film or television production. This includes helping with budgeting, scheduling, coordinating crew and resources, and ensuring that production runs smoothly and stays on track. The Assistant Line Producer acts as a liaison between departments, helps resolve logistical issues, and may assist with paperwork and contracts. Their organizational skills help keep the production efficient and within budget.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ant line producer?

To thrive as an Assistant Line Producer, you need strong organizational skills, budgeting knowledge, and experience in production management, often supported by a degree in film, television, or a related field. Familiarity with production scheduling software like Movie Magic Scheduling and Budgeting, as well as understanding union regulations and permitting systems, is crucial.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and adaptability help manage logistics and coordinate between departments. These skills ensure productions run smoothly, on time, and within budget, which is critical to a project's success.

The Assistant Line Producer and Production Coordinator roles both support production teams in film and television. While the Assistant Line Producer focuses more on assisting with budget management, scheduling, and overall production support, the Production Coordinator handles logistics, communication, and coordination across departments. Both roles require strong organizational skills and industry experience, but the Assistant Line Producer typically has more involvement in financial and scheduling decisions.

NewsNation Segment Producer, Morning in America (Chicago)

NewsNation is looking for a Segment Producer to join the team for its weekday flagship morning broadcast, Morning in America. This role involves contributing story ideas, compiling elements, and crafting engaging live segments on a wide range of topics. The Segment Producer collaborates closely with the Executive Producer, Senior Producers, and Line Producers to ensure accurate and compelling broadcasts. The position is based at the network headquarters in Chicago.

Duties & Responsibilities:

Produce live guest segments and correspondent hits for Morning in America.

Collaborate closely with NewsNation correspondents to produce compelling and accurate live hits and update with new details throughout the show.

Locate strongest possible elements to be used in guest segments and live correspondent hits - including video, graphics, lower thirds - and load them into the rundown quickly and accurately.

Write, organize, and produce scripts, including but not limited to teases, VO readers, longer form Q&As, and tracked packages.

Keep Executive Producer and Senior Producer apprised of developments of stories.

Assist in the control room if needed.

Perform other duties as assigned by Executive Producer and Senior Producer or network leadership.

Requirements & Skills:

Experience producing for a national news program or producing newscasts in a top 10 market.

Experience covering politics and government.

Strong news judgment.

Quick decision maker and creative thinker.

Effective coach and mentor to staff of all experience levels.

Collaborative team player who advocates for their show but find ways to elevate network reporting.

Bachelor's degree in journalism, or a related field, or an equivalent combination of education and work-related experience.

Excellent communication skills, both oral and written.

Ability to adapt to change, meet deadlines, prioritize assignments, and handle multiple tasks simultaneously.

Proficiency with ENPS Proficiency with Adobe Premiere or another video editing software preferred.

Flexibility to work different shifts.
